The acting head of the OSCE, foreign Minister of Switzerland Didier Burkhalter called the past in Ukraine's parliamentary elections " an important step towards stabilizing the situation in the country, according to a press release, published on the first day of the week.
" This election was an important step in the commitment of Ukraine to consolidate democratic elections in Accordance with their international obligations, " the document says.
Burkhalter had paid my respects all Citizens of Ukraine with participation in the parliamentary elections, and expressed gratitude to the members of the observer mission from the OSCE / ODIHR observers from the OSCE PA, as well as other international institutions for participation in the elections.
According to the head of the OSCE Minsk minutes dated September 5, Minsk Memorandum dated September 19, are the necessary basis for decisions fall in the country. Burkhalter tried to convince all stakeholders in full force to meet its obligations under these documents, for example, regarding the cease-fire and an effective surveillance of the Russian-Ukrainian border.
Early parliamentary elections were held in Ukraine on Sunday. After counting 50, 08% of the protocols on party lists for elections to the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ine is the leader of the " popular front " Prime Minister Arseniy Yatsenyuk 21, 61% of the vote, inform the Data of the CEC of Ukraine." Block Petro Poroshenko types 21, 45% of the vote.
according to the CEC, Radu are still four Parties." Self-help of the mayor of Lviv Andriy Sadovy gaining eleven, 1% of the vote, " the Opposition Bloc ", which includes most of the former members of the Party of regions, - 9, 82%, " Radical party of Oleh Liashko " - 7, 38%, Batkivshchyna former Prime Minister Yulia Tymoshenko - 5, 69% of the vote.
